WebAug 29, 2024 · Ear irrigation, also known as ear lavage, is a procedure to remove ear wax that can build up in the ear canal and block part or all of it. Ear wax, or cerumen, is a substance with antibacterial properties made by glands in your outer ears. Earwax, also known by the medical term cerumen, is a brown, orange, red, yellowish or gray waxy substance secreted in the ear canal of humans and other mammals. It protects the skin of the human ear canal, assists in cleaning and lubrication, and provides protection against bacteria, fungi, and water.
